What Exactly Are Idle Games?
Key Attributes | Description |
---|---|
Auto Progress | Mechanisms where characters or processes evolve with minimal interaction from players |
Reward Systems | Incentives like coins or achievements given for brief periods of activity, sometimes without prolonged input |
Progress-Based Upgrades | Mechanical advancements achieved either through continuous logins, micro-engagements, or strategic decision-making |
- Simple interface requiring limited manual input
- Prioritized background tasks for player multitasking
- Balances depth with low pressure environments
An idle game's allure hinges on its ability to maintain a balance between active and automatic functionality, giving players space for mental wandering while still providing incremental development over time. Fueling Growth Through Engaging Simplicity
Simplistic designs often disguise deeper layers beneath idle games. Players who casually tap, drag, and automate systems might not consciously think, *I’m acquiring analytical reasoning today,* yet such experiences cultivate subtle competencies.
Traits Developed | Impact on Cognitive Growth |
---|---|
Pattern Recognition | Identifying cycles and resource fluctuations in games fosters awareness applicable to scientific observations or financial planning later in life |
Decision-Making Under Uncertainty | Selecting investments during unpredictable in-game conditions mimics economic forecasting or risk modeling situations students will encounter professionally |
Patient Planning | Certain upgrades require multi-step execution and long wait times, building resilience against immediate gratification and teaching forward vision |
